Prevention of thrombus formation and/or stabilization with inhibitors of factor XII or activated factor XII
The present invention relates to the use of at least one antibody and/or one inhibitor for inhibiting factor XII and preventing the formation and/or the stabilization of three-dimensional thrombi. It also relates to a pharmaceutical formulation and the use of factor XII as an anti-thrombotic target.
